If you happen to find yourself in Naples, Florida, check out a new gallery called The Art Boutique at Tin City. It's located in the front section of the buildings closest to Rte 41 and it's next to The Wine Store. After sampling some Florida wines you can browse the Boutique where you'll find some whimsical stoneware sculpture , some beautiful and well priced fused glass and a bunch of paintings, cards and prints by yours truly. Everything in this gallery is priced right. Stop by and try some wine and meet Mary, Julie or Charles who are working the gallery. As for today's painting. I bought this wonderful glass block vase at Goodwill store but haven't used it much. It's full of angles and reflections and could drive a painter nuts. It did me.
